Section R. 324.8913 - Approvable watershed management plans

Rule 13.

(1) A local unit of government or a nonprofit entity may submit a watershed management plan to the department for approval under these rules.

(2) A watershed plan submitted to the department for approval under this rule shall be detailed, current, and identify all of the following:

(a) The geographic scope of the watershed.

(b) The designated uses and desired uses of the watershed.

(c) The water quality threats or impairments in the watershed.

(d) The causes of the impairments or threats, including pollutants.

(e) A clear statement of the water quality improvement or protection goals of the watershed plan.

(f) The sources of the pollutants causing the impairments or threats of impairments.

(g) The sources of the pollutants that are critical to control in order to meet water quality standards or other water quality goals.

(h) The tasks and their estimated costs that need to be completed to prevent or control the critical sources of pollution or address causes of impairment, including, as appropriate, all of the following:
(i) The best management practices needed.

(ii) Revisions needed or proposed to local zoning ordinances and other land use management tools.

(iii) Informational and educational activities needed.

(iv) Activities needed to institutionalize watershed protection.

(i) A summary of the public participation process, including the opportunity for public comment during watershed plan development and the partners that were involved in the development of the watershed plan.

(j) The estimated periods of time needed to complete each task and the proposed sequence of task completion.

(k) A description of the process that will be used to evaluate the effectiveness of implementing the plan and achieving its goals.

(3) The department shall accept and review watershed plans submitted for approval under this rule any time throughout the year.

(4) The department shall have 90 days to take action on watershed plans submitted for approval. Taking action may include approving, rejecting, or commenting.
